englischIn the public debate about cognitive enhancement (CE), the media is often accused of hyping the subject and contributing to the fact that more and more people are using drugs to improve their mental performance. Despite these claims, little is known about the role of journalists and the intensity and content of media coverage of CE. Conducting both a content analysis of German press coverage and 30 interviews with journalists that recently reported about CE, this book explores if there is evidence of such media hype. It examines how the German media reports on cognitive enhancement, what role German journalists play in the debate, which mechanisms underlie media coverage and what consequences are to be expected.
